St. Wojciech's Church was built in 1908-1912 in the neo-Romanesque style with donations from German manufacturers. Until the end of World War II, the church was Protestant and belonged to the Consistory of the Evangelical Augsburg Church. In 1945, he converted to the Roman Catholic Church, consecrated in honor of St. Wojciech. Author. Jan Wende, Lodz architect. The church fascinates with its beauty and monumental appearance. Thick red brick walls, rounded arches, small window openings, stepways, beautiful turrets, and white exterior decor create the impression that this is not a church, but a fabulous castle or fortress. A street clock is installed on the upper tower on four sides. Once inside the Church, one is struck and surprised by the huge interior space, which is difficult to even imagine from the outside. The interior of the Church, the organ, the chandelier and the stained glass windows enchant with their beauty. Six stained glass windows were made in 1957, one of them depicts Saint Wojciech. The Church of St. Wojciech is free to visit, admission is free, but as in any religious object there are special places for voluntary donations for the maintenance of the Temple. Photography is allowed, which is very important for tourists.
